Model Theory

study guides for every class

that actually explain what's on your next test

Interpolation Theorem

from class:

Model Theory

Definition

The Interpolation Theorem states that if a formula is provable from a set of axioms, then there exists an intermediate formula that can be inferred using the information contained in those axioms. This theorem showcases the relationship between syntactic provability and the existence of intermediate statements, highlighting the way logical consequences unfold in a given structure.

congrats on reading the definition of Interpolation Theorem.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. The Interpolation Theorem is crucial for understanding how information flows through logical systems, as it provides a method to identify intermediate steps in proofs.
  2. In many cases, the intermediate formula derived from the theorem can be used to demonstrate properties of a model or system without needing to reference the original axioms directly.
  3. The theorem has implications in various areas, including algebra, computer science, and automated reasoning, as it helps in constructing proofs and simplifying arguments.
  4. Interpolation can be connected to concepts like consistency and independence within a theory, giving insights into the strength and limitations of certain logical systems.
  5. The Interpolation Theorem plays a key role in demonstrating model completeness because it allows for constructing specific instances or formulas that maintain truth across different interpretations.

Review Questions

  • How does the Interpolation Theorem illustrate the connection between provability and intermediate formulas?
    • The Interpolation Theorem shows that if a certain formula can be proven from a set of axioms, there exists an intermediate formula that lies logically between them. This means that instead of jumping from axioms directly to conclusions, one can identify intermediate statements that are necessary for establishing the result. This connection helps clarify how logical reasoning unfolds and ensures that each step is grounded in previously established truths.
  • Discuss how the Interpolation Theorem is related to model completeness and its importance in logical frameworks.
    • The Interpolation Theorem's relationship to model completeness lies in its ability to construct intermediate formulas that remain true across various interpretations. In model completeness, every definable set is determined by formulas that do not require quantifiers. The theorem assists in this process by ensuring that we can find these intermediary statements without losing logical consistency, thereby supporting the framework where every theory has a corresponding complete model.
  • Evaluate the significance of the Interpolation Theorem in practical applications such as automated reasoning and computer science.
    • The significance of the Interpolation Theorem in practical applications like automated reasoning is profound. It provides algorithms with strategies for breaking down complex proofs into simpler parts by identifying intermediate formulas. This not only enhances efficiency in proving theorems but also aids in error detection and validation processes within software systems. Furthermore, it serves as a foundation for various computational techniques used in artificial intelligence to reason about knowledge bases effectively.
ยฉ 2024 Fiveable Inc. All rights reserved.
APยฎ and SATยฎ are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ides